Klaus Müller is a scholar working on Molecular Biology, Food Science and Plant Science. According to data from OpenAlex, Klaus Müller has authored 14 papers receiving a total of 409 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Molecular Biology, 5 papers in Food Science and 4 papers in Plant Science. Recurrent topics in Klaus Müller's work include Proteins in Food Systems (5 papers), Protein Hydrolysis and Bioactive Peptides (4 papers) and Phytase and its Applications (4 papers). Klaus Müller is often cited by papers focused on Proteins in Food Systems (5 papers), Protein Hydrolysis and Bioactive Peptides (4 papers) and Phytase and its Applications (4 papers). Klaus Müller collaborates with scholars based in Germany, South Africa and Nigeria. Klaus Müller's co-authors include Amanda Minnaar, Joseph Oneh Abu, Kwaku G. Duodu, Peter Eisner, Markus Schmid, Stephanie Bader‐Mittermaier, Douglas Fernandes Barbin, Andreas Natsch, Yumiko Yoshie-Stark and Bruno Lewin and has published in prestigious journals such as Food Chemistry, Industrial Crops and Products and Journal of Food Processing and Preservation.
